NOVAL DIVORCE SUIT

NEW Y'OEK. August 17

A young woman sought the annulment of her marriage on the ground that her husband during courtship was guilty of false representations of his finances and social standing. The Judge, in dismissing the case, remarked that during the mental exaltation accompanying courtship statements regarding the mental, moral, and financial qualifications of the parties must not be too closelv examined.
